What is Email Checker Laravel?
Email checker Laravel is a package that provides email validation functionality to Laravel applications. These packages use various methods, including regular expressions and SMTP verification, to determine the validity of email addresses. Some packages also provide email correction and suggestion features.

Features of Email Checker Laravel
Email checker Laravel packages come with a range of features that can help you validate email addresses in your Laravel application. These features can include regular expression-based validation, SMTP verification, email correction and suggestion, and disposable email address detection. Some packages even offer integration with third-party services, such as Mailgun and SendGrid.

Limitations of Email Checker Laravel
While email checker Laravel packages are useful, they have some limitations. These packages may not detect all invalid email addresses, and they may also incorrectly identify some valid email addresses as invalid. Additionally, SMTP verification can be slow and may not be suitable for applications with high email validation volumes.
